2 less for NY Fashion Week

Monique Lhuillier, spring 2009

"And then there were … two less. Vera Wang, Betsey Johnson, and Carmen Marc Valvo have opted out of Bryant Park runway shows, and now Monique Lhuillier and Naeem Khan have decided to do the same in favor of presentations. Paul Wilmot, whose PR firm represents both designers, said the moves aren't even about saving a quick buck. In fact, Wilmot said the designers might not spend any less money. Apparently they just want to "shake things up a bit." But is this change we can believe in? “Before, there’s that one degree of separation — the press and the buyers get a different sense of the clothing when they’re flying past you on the runway as opposed to being able to stand next to them and having the fashion designer talk about the clothes,” Wilmot says.

Excellent point & presentations could be a better sales strategy. But are they the future while runway shows merely walk the path to Obsolete Park? As Cathy Horyn noted a while back, shows aren't even necessary these days. Anyone can look at the clothes online minutes after they end, and the only function the shows seem to serve is to preserve the egos of the people with the good seats (i.e., that episode of the Real Housewives of New York where Jill storms out of the tents because Ramona got a front-row seat while she got a second-row seat). So bring on the presentations and force the important people to mingle with the lowly bloggers like us. Come fall 2009, everyone's front row!" by Amy Odell

The Fashion Winehouse

05 January 2009, 10:07AM

SHE has stepped out of the line of paparazzi fire recently but after the annus horribilis that was 2008, word has it that Amy Winehouse is preparing to make a spectacular public comeback - as a fashion designer.

According to the tabloids, the Rehab singer let slip during a festive holiday that she is currently in negotiations with iconic British label Fred Perry and has already started sketching out a few of her ideas.

"She was almost childishly excited and couldn't stop talking about it," a source told The Sun.

She may have spent 2008 beset by personal problems but for some, a Winehouse foray into fashion could seem overdue; not only did her distinctive look dictate the styling of Karl Lagerfeld's Paris-Londres Metiers d'Art collection for Chanel in 2007 but Roberto Cavalli has previously declared her "a fashion icon because she is unique", and London-based footwear designer Jonathan Kelsey created a stiletto, the Amy, in her honour - which she was promptly photographed wearing.

Ethiopia: Peoples of the Omo Valley

"In this ambitious work, Hans Silvester turns his photographic eye toward ancient Africa, the birthplace of humanity. Silvester was essentially adopted by his subjects during his travels, and his stunning color photographs present a rare, intimate view of their world."

"The first volume of this deluxe two-volume set presents the everyday lives of the Omo people, their rituals, parades, children’s games, and even their battles. In the second volume, each photograph becomes a masterpiece of abstract art, revealing close-ups of the tribes’ traditional body paintings. Silvester’s accompanying text traces his journey to the Horn of Africa, revealing the fascinating beauty of a world now in danger of extinction."
